How to see it

HIP 86481 has a visual magnitude of about 6.90: it usually needs binoculars or a small telescope, especially from light-polluted sites.

Sky position

Equatorial coordinates for HIP 86481: right ascension 17h 40m 17s, declination +69° 9′ 3″ (J2000), in the region of the Draco constellation (IAU figure Dra).
